Transaction 21c698e7a0b383a176ac896743ce39bb66f059d62cb4a5ebd3df19b6abc89f63
1 Input
1 Output
-
21c698e7a0b383a176ac896743ce39bb66f059d62cb4a5ebd3df19b6abc89f63:0
- value
- 145573
- script pubkey
- OP_0 OP_PUSHBYTES_20 b59420eae4d12413299eeb4120ecb5b74e2e90bb
- address
- bc1qkk2zp6hy6yjpx2v7adqjpm94ka8zay9my5nne2